5 easy weekend getaways for spring

Guestroom

From beachfront hotels to snowy mountain retreats, we have an easy—and affordable—weekend getaway for you.

Southeast: Florida Coast Stay: B Ocean Fort Lauderdale

The 240 rooms at this hotel come with white-on-white leather furnishings and equally fabulous ocean views. There’s a heated infinity pool, a spa suite, a fitness center, and a few dining options including Saia, a sushi restaurant. Guests are also treated to complimentary Wi-Fi, iPad rentals, and Aveda bath products. Doubles from $199/night on weekends.

Northeast: Catskills, NY Stay: The Graham & Co., Phoenicia, NY

A three-hour drive from New York City, the Graham & Co. is a new retro-chic inn that’s great for families. The décor has a Brooklyn-feel to it, notably the hanging Edison lights and reclaimed-wood tables. There’s an outside fire pit, and bikes available to borrow. Special winter offers include discount ski tickets at nearby Hunter Mountain. Doubles from $99/night on weekends.

 

West Coast: Northern California Coast Stay: Agate Cove Inn, Mendocino, CA

This farmhouse and collection of cottages are set on a bluff above the Pacific, about a three-hour drive from San Francisco. There are wildflower gardens on the grounds, as well as cypress and redwood trees. If you stay between December and April, you’ll have a chance to see whales passing by out at sea. You can also take part in lawn games such as croquet, badminton, and bocce. A full breakfast and Wi-Fi are included. Doubles from $189/night on weekends.

Midwest: Lake Geneva, WI Stay: Grand Geneva Resort, WI

Within a two-hour drive from Chicago, this 355-guestroom resort with Frank Lloyd Wright–inspired architecture is great for active families. Kids climb the rock wall, take cooking and dancing classes, and let loose at both indoor and outdoor swimming pools and tennis courts. At The Mountain Top at Grand Geneva Resort, there are 18 slopes for downhill skiing, a snowboard terrain park, and 10 km of cross-country trails.  Doubles from $209/night on weekends.

Southwest: Utah Stay: Lodge at Red River Ranch, Teasdale, UT

A little over three hours from Salt Lake City, this lodge is set on 2,000 acres a few minutes from Capitol Reef National Park and is also accessible to Arches National Park and Zion National Park. There are 15 guest rooms and suites with rustic furnishings, wood-burning fireplaces, and private balconies or garden patios. The 3-story tall Great Room has a floor-to-ceiling fireplace, game area, and a piano. But you won’t want to linger inside for too long—the lodge is in a prime spot for fishing, hiking, horseback riding, and rock climbing. Doubles from $160/night on weekends.
